Sec. 262.204. TEMPORARY ORDER IN EFFECT UNTIL SUPERSEDED.

(a)A temporary order rendered under this chapter is valid and enforceable until properly superseded by a court with jurisdiction to do so.
(b)A court to which the suit has been transferred may enforce by contempt or otherwise a temporary order properly issued under this chapter.
